PUBLIC NOTICES. LAST CALL. QN SUNDAY LAST the Block Captains made their final house calls. Should any persons in future contract influenza, will they please at once l'otify the Health Bureau, Egmont St.; I'iionc 700? It will materially assist the Committee if people -will at oDce notify us should any neighbour become ill. E. GRIFFITHS, .Secretary. V-A-D.'S FOR THE HOSPITAL. QWIXG to the opening of business premises yesterday, the Matron is losing the help of several girls who have been giving invaluable help. The shortage must be replaced immediately. Will any girls willing to help please report as early as possible to the Matron ,or |th.i Health Bureau, Egmont Streat. E. GRIFFITH}, Secretaij.... NOTICE.
